Main Points 1. God is both the source of love and love itself (vv. 7–8). 2. God defined love by sending His Son to save us (vv. 9–10). 3. God's love for us motivates our love for others (v. 11). This sermon centers on the nature and implications of God's love as revealed in 1 John 4, emphasizing that God is both the source and essence of love, not merely its origin. It argues that genuine love is a divine mark of spiritual rebirth, rooted in the believer's relationship with God, and that true love is defined not by human effort but by God's sacrificial act in sending His Son to atone for sin through propitiation. The passage underscores that God's love—demonstrated in Christ's death—is the foundation and motivation for believers to love one another, not out of self-effort but through the empowering presence of the Holy Spirit. The message calls for a response of obedience, forgiveness, and service, grounded in the reality of God's love, and challenges listeners to examine their lives for evidence of this divine love, while extending it to others as a natural outflow of grace received.
